Hi,

Ahead of Thursday's disaster-recovery drill, please confirm the Falconmere telemetry pipeline fails over cleanly with zstd compression enabled. Last quarter, the Bramblewick ingest nodes silently fell back to uncompressed payloads, tripling bandwidth during recovery and masking the real failover time. For this drill we will validate compressed-payload checksums end to end and record restore latency in the Moorhaven runbook. If the standby compressor's keystore needs to be unsealed during the drill, use the passphrase below.

recovery phrase for bawef-haduf: wenax-druox-julmir

Handoff for Ostrel's planner regression, relevant to plugin authors: v4.2 changed join-cost estimates, so custom index hints from plugins may be ignored. We pinned the legacy cost model until the fix lands. Plugins should target the pinned behavior and test against the current planner settings shown below.

settings of bawif-fawif:
ralix:
  log_level: warn
  metrics_host: metrics.ralix.tolvaqsys.internal
  pool_size: 32

Hi Teo — handover for the holiday stretch at Corven House. Main doors lock at 16:00 from the 23rd, and reception is dark until the 3rd, so anyone legit turning up goes through the courtyard entrance. The contractor list is pinned to the desk monitor; nobody not on it gets in, even if they're charming about it. Bins go out Tuesday as normal, and the plant watering rota is in the top drawer. For the courtyard door, use the holiday access code below.

staff pass of kawip-hawef = bdg-QLP-2